2. Pokémon Sword & Shield
The road to Pokémon Sword & Shield has been a bumpy one, with outrage over Dexit and poor graphics, as well as this feeling like a missed opportunity. As the first mainline game on a home console (Let’s Go! not withstanding), it could have been a giant leap forward. Breath Of The Wild with Pokémon was what optimistic fans had hoped for.
Even though it seems like it’s going to be a fairly standard Pokémon game just a bit bigger with more depth, that’s more than enough to make it one of the most anticipated releases still to come in 2019.
Set in the Galar region, British trainers are even more excited as it means the game is finally coming to our sunny shores. With the intriguing introduction of Max Raid Battles allowing you to play online and a new Wild Area where rarer ‘mons roam, there’s a lot to look forward to.
Devs bragging about a player controlled camera feels slightly worrying as this has been a basic feature in other games for decades, but progress is progress.
As usual, Pokémon skates by on the cuteness of its designs. It’s hard to hate them for it when you stare into Wooloo’s eyes.
